

As a young man he moved to Baltimore, working as a machinist at Bethlehem Steel and later going into the carpet business with his wife Doris. Al continued to run Owl’s Carpet Works into his early 90’s.
Al was known for his warm smile, jokes, and storytelling. He loved fishing, boating, football, softball, and duckpin bowling. He was active in United States Power Squadron and Baltimore Yacht Club serving as Commodore in 1982.
In his later years, he enjoyed bingo, watching the Ravens and Orioles, and socializing with family and friends. He was dearly loved and will be deeply missed.
Al was preceded in death by his wife, Doris, and by his parents and siblings. He is survived by his nephews Thomas C. and Gerard T. Chaney, and many loving extended family members.
